Deck Building Cost in Seattle

Deck Building projects in Seattle cost $5,400 to $54,000, with a median of $13,200 and an average of $18,000. That's 20% above the national average, based on 253 real contractor quotes adjusted for Seattle's labor rates and market conditions.

Deck Building cost in Seattle at a glance

Project ScopeSeattle AverageSeattle Range
Pressure-Treated (300 sq ft)$9,000$5,400 – $12,000
Cedar (300 sq ft)$14,400$9,600 – $19,200
Composite (300 sq ft)$18,000$12,000 – $26,400
Hardwood / Ipe (300 sq ft)$30,000$21,600 – $42,000

Seattle vs. national pricing

Seattle deck building costs run 20% higher than the national average. Seattle labor rates run $55-$135/hour, 15-25% above the national average.

Seattle vs. national deck building costs

Project ScopeNational RangeSeattle Range
Pressure-Treated (300 sq ft)$4,500 – $10,000$5,400 – $12,000
Cedar (300 sq ft)$8,000 – $16,000$9,600 – $19,200
Composite (300 sq ft)$10,000 – $22,000$12,000 – $26,400
Hardwood / Ipe (300 sq ft)$18,000 – $35,000$21,600 – $42,000

What drives deck building costs in Seattle

Deck Building projects in Seattle typically cost 20% above the national average. Seattle labor rates run $55-$135/hour, 15-25% above the national average. Tech-driven population growth has increased demand for quality contractors.

Seattle DCI requires permits for most renovation work. The city's energy code is among the strictest in the US, adding cost to HVAC, window, and insulation projects. Permit review times average 4-6 weeks. Persistent rain and moisture make waterproofing, mold prevention, and proper ventilation critical for every project. Mild temperatures mean heating costs are moderate but humidity management is essential.

Craftsman bungalows, mid-century ramblers, and newer townhomes. Many homes built on hillsides with daylight basements. Moisture intrusion is the most common issue in older homes.
